Buy one get one 50%off, You know I had to stock up. The best part about this sale is that it lasts until Feb. 22nd. So, you already know I will keep stocking up their products (...yay me!!!!...lol).

 Did I mention I love SheaMoisture hair products?Lol..... Especially most of their products from their Organic Coconut & Hibiscus Line for Thick and Curly hair & Organic Raw Shea Butter Moisture Retention Line for Dry, Damaged Hair. Coco and I, will be posting reviews on those products soon.

They also have two other lines that I will be trying soon the Organic Yucca & Baobab Line for fine/thin hair & the Organic African Black Soap Line for dry & itchy scalps.
